[wp-trac] [WordPress Trac] #38472: Twenty Seventeen - improve front end display in Internet Explorer 8 (was: Twentyseventeen - improve front end display in Internet Explorer 8)

WordPress Trac noreply at wordpress.org
Mon Oct 24 15:24:20 UTC 2016


#38472: Twenty Seventeen - improve front end display in Internet Explorer 8
-----------------------------------------+--------------------
 Reporter:  adamsilverstein              |       Owner:
     Type:  defect (bug)                 |      Status:  new
 Priority:  normal                       |   Milestone:  4.7
Component:  Themes                       |     Version:  trunk
 Severity:  normal                       |  Resolution:
 Keywords:  needs-patch has-screenshots  |     Focuses:
-----------------------------------------+--------------------
Description changed by adamsilverstein:

Old description:

> Twentyseventeen "should look okay and be functional" in IE8. We are not
> aiming for perfect.
>
> I did some testing in Browserstack and noticed several issues I hope we
> can fix these as they make the theme pretty unusable for ie8 users.
>
> Starting with the home page:
>
> * Site title missing style and at top instead of bottom of page
> * Menu located mid-page
> * No indication of more content below
>
> [[Image(https://cl.ly/41262v0X2b2k/Image%202016-10-24%20at%2010.42.19%20AM.png)]]
>
> Setting a static front page results in that page's content overlapping
> the home page image:
>
> [[Image(https://cl.ly/041I0h2q3w0v/Dashboard_2016-10-24_10-48-22.jpg)]]
>

> The menu functions, however I'm getting the mobile menu, and the SVG
> icons are missing (hamburger bars and close):
>
> [[Image(https://cl.ly/2J3u2e3L2A2T/Dashboard_2016-10-24_10-45-19.jpg)]]
>

> Single posts show the full size splash image (not just the header bar),
> and the content is completely missing (not visible):
>
> [[Image(https://cl.ly/0h331n2E212x/Dashboard_2016-10-24_11-15-29.jpg)]]
>
> Screencast: https://cl.ly/2o3n163Q0543
>
> It looks like the issue here is the header background image is covering
> the entire page content... using ie debug tools i removed the `custom-
> header-image` div's background image, revealing the page content below,
> although the sidebars also appear to be missing in action (removing the
> image in the customizer also made the content visible in ie8)
>
> [[Image(https://cl.ly/3o1A3r3F0u3C/Dashboard_2016-10-24_10-56-25.jpg)]]
>
> Compared to the correct appearance in chrome:
>
> [[Image(https://cl.ly/2z1h3N190h3N/Hello_world__wpdev_2016-10-24_11-00-12.jpg)]]

New description:

 Twenty Seventeen "should look okay and be functional" in IE8. We are not
 aiming for perfect.

 I did some testing in Browserstack and noticed several issues I hope we
 can fix these as they make the theme pretty unusable for ie8 users.

 Starting with the home page:

 * Site title missing style and at top instead of bottom of page
 * Menu located mid-page
 * No indication of more content below

 [[Image(https://cl.ly/41262v0X2b2k/Image%202016-10-24%20at%2010.42.19%20AM.png)]]

 Setting a static front page results in that page's content overlapping the
 home page image:

 [[Image(https://cl.ly/041I0h2q3w0v/Dashboard_2016-10-24_10-48-22.jpg)]]


 The menu functions, however I'm getting the mobile menu, and the SVG icons
 are missing (hamburger bars and close):

 [[Image(https://cl.ly/2J3u2e3L2A2T/Dashboard_2016-10-24_10-45-19.jpg)]]


 Single posts show the full size splash image (not just the header bar),
 and the content is completely missing (not visible):

 [[Image(https://cl.ly/0h331n2E212x/Dashboard_2016-10-24_11-15-29.jpg)]]

 Screencast: https://cl.ly/2o3n163Q0543

 It looks like the issue here is the header background image is covering
 the entire page content... using ie debug tools i removed the `custom-
 header-image` div's background image, revealing the page content below,
 although the sidebars also appear to be missing in action (removing the
 image in the customizer also made the content visible in ie8)

 [[Image(https://cl.ly/3o1A3r3F0u3C/Dashboard_2016-10-24_10-56-25.jpg)]]

 Compared to the correct appearance in chrome:

 [[Image(https://cl.ly/2z1h3N190h3N/Hello_world__wpdev_2016-10-24_11-00-12.jpg)]]

--

--
Ticket URL: <https://core.trac.wordpress.org/ticket/38472#comment:3>
WordPress Trac <https://core.trac.wordpress.org/>
WordPress publishing platform


More information about the wp-trac mailing list